What is NIMONIC 75 material?

NIMONIC 75 alloy is an 80/20 nickel-chromium alloy with added titanium and carbon. This alloy was originally introduced in the 1940s for the manufacture of turbine blades. It is easy to machine and weld, and possesses good corrosion resistance, mechanical properties, and heat resistance.

5. Gnee Steel's Customizable Cutting Methods

Laser Cutting: Suitable for machining complex shapes and high-precision parts. Fiber lasers are used for cutting stainless steel and nickel-based alloys where extremely high precision is required.

Waterjet Cutting: Suitable for thicker nickel-based alloy sheets, enabling high-precision cutting with no heat-affected zone (HAZ).

Shearing Machine Cutting: Used for rapid, straight-line cutting of sheet metal, capable of machining high-strength alloys up to 3 mm thick.

Band Saw Cutting: Ideal for cutting thick bars or profiles, offering single-piece or batch processing services.

Q2: Why does Nimonic 90 cost more than Nimonic 75?

A: Nimonic 90 contains roughly 15-21% Cobalt (Co), which is an expensive strategic metal. The Cobalt significantly enhances the alloy's strength at temperatures above 800°C, making it a "premium" grade compared to the solid-solution Nimonic 75.
